Why These Are the Top Audi Repair Auto Repair Shops in Cleveland

** The Audi repair market for residents of Cleveland, Minnesota, is entirely dependent on the nearby Mankato area. Cleveland itself offers no specialized Audi services. The market in Mankato is moderately competitive with a few high-quality, independent specialists that effectively serve the regional demand for European auto repair. The average quality of these top-tier specialists is very high, often exceeding that of a general dealership in terms of personalized service and value, while matching their technical expertise. Competition is healthy, keeping pricing fair but reflective of the specialized labor and genuine parts required. Typical pricing for Audi repair in this market is premium, with standard labor rates ranging from **$130 - $170 per hour**. Owners should expect a higher cost of ownership compared to domestic or Asian brands, but the presence of these reputable independents provides excellent alternatives to the more expensive dealership network located in the Twin Cities metro area.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about audi repair services in Cleveland, MN

Where can I find a qualified Audi repair shop near Cleveland, MN, and what should I look for?

Given Cleveland's rural location, you may need to look in nearby larger communities like Mankato or St. Peter for a specialist. Look for a shop with certified Audi/VW technicians (ASE or factory-trained), specialized diagnostic tools for Audi's complex systems, and strong reviews from other European car owners.

Are Audi repairs more expensive in the Cleveland area compared to standard brands?

Yes, due to specialized parts, required expertise, and sophisticated technology, Audi repairs are typically more expensive than domestic or Asian brands. In our region, sourcing specific parts can sometimes add time and cost, so getting a detailed estimate upfront from a shop experienced with European vehicles is crucial.

What are the most common Audi repair issues for drivers in the Cleveland, Minnesota climate?

Harsh winters with road salt accelerate corrosion of suspension components and brake lines. Quattro all-wheel-drive system services and diagnostics are also common, as are issues related to complex electrical systems and sensors that can be sensitive to Minnesota's extreme temperature swings and humidity.

When should I seek local service versus going to a dealership for my Audi?

For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) and many common repairs, a trusted local independent shop specializing in European cars can offer significant savings and personalized service. For major warranty work, complex software updates, or specific recalls, the nearest Audi dealerships in the Twin Cities or Rochester may be necessary.

How does driving on rural Le Sueur County roads impact my Audi's service needs?

Gravel roads and seasonal potholes can be tough on Audi's performance suspension and low-profile tires, leading to more frequent alignment checks, tire replacements, and potential wheel or control arm damage. It's wise to have your suspension inspected regularly, especially in spring after the frost thaws.
